i am a windows xp home edition user. i am in need of the information server
program, which was not installed with the xp edition installation. what is
the best way to attain a copy & get it installed into windows? is it
downloadable?

No, and it won't run on XP Home either. If you need to run IIS
specifically, you need to upgrade to XP Pro.

You can, alternately, locate some other web server that does run on XP Home.
However, you may run into some of the other network limitations of XP Home.
